| Standard Name | Arr1p |
|---|---|
| Systematic Name | Ypr199cp |
| Alias | Yap8p 1 , Acr1p 2 |
| ORF Classification | Verified |
| Description | Transcriptional activator of the basic leucine zipper (bZIP) family, required for transcription of genes involved in resistance to arsenic compounds (2, 3, 4) |
| Name Description | ARsenicals Resistance |
